Services
Select Menu > Media > Services (network service).
Services is one of the two browsers in your device. With Services, you can browse WAP pages that have been designed specially
for mobile devices. For example, operators may have WAP pages for mobile devices. To browse regular Web pages, use the other
browser in Menu > Web.
Check the availability of services, pricing, and fees with your network operator or service provider. Service providers will also
give you instructions on how to use their services.
